Impostare la lingua italiana nel sistema: differenze tra le versioni

Da Guide@Debianizzati.Org.
Vai alla navigazione Vai alla ricerca
(solo per sarge)
(+ verifica ed estensione)
Riga 1: Riga 1:
{{Old}}{{Versioni compatibili|Sarge}}
{{Versioni compatibili}}
__TOC__
== Installer ==
==Introduzione==
Durante l'installazione di Debian verrà chiesto esplicitamente la lingua da utilizzare.<br/>
Per ottenere che le interfacce dei nostri programmi ci siano presentate in italiano avremo bisogno di due pacchetti: si tratta di '''locales''' e '''localeconf'''.
Questa sarà la lingua non solo adottata nei passi successivi dell'installazione ma anche, ad installazione ultimata, per l'intero sistema.<br/>
{{Warningbox|A partire da Debian Etch 4.0 il pacchetto '''localeconf''' non è più necessario}}
[[Image:Locale3.png|center|link=]]
==Installazione e configurazione==
Ciò che viene indicato qui condizionerà anche la lista dei repository raccomandati dall'installer. In ogni modo tutte le scelte fatte potranno essere facilmente cambiate in futuro.
Provvediamo dunque a scaricare i pacchetti necessari con l'abituale:
<pre># apt-get install locales localeconf</pre>
Una volta terminato il download ci verrà presentata la classica interfaccia di debconf relativa alla configurazione dei due pacchetti appena scaricati.


'''[LOCALES]''' questo pacchetto gestisce la generazione/manutenzione delle localizzazioni dei vari pacchetti:
== La lingua di sistema ==
Il programma ci invita a scegliere quali "locales" e cioè localizzazioni dovrà provvedere a generare. Quello che ci interessa è <code>it_IT@euro ISO-8859-15</code> quindi scegliamolo e proseguiamo. Ora dobbiamo scegliere quale sarà il nostro default - evidentemente sempre <code>it_IT@euro</code>.
La lingua utilizzata è indicata dalla variabile d'ambiente "LANG", per visualizzarla:
La prima fase si conclude qui.
<pre>$ echo $LANG</pre>
Oppure si può adoperare il comando <code>locale</code>:
<pre>$ locale</pre>
Questa, per una localizzazione in italiano, dovrebbe apparire così:
<pre>
$ echo $LANG
it_IT.UTF-8
</pre>
o, con <code>locale</code>:
'''LANG=it_IT.UTF-8'''
LANGUAGE=
LC_CTYPE="it_IT.UTF-8"
LC_NUMERIC="it_IT.UTF-8"
LC_TIME="it_IT.UTF-8"
LC_COLLATE="it_IT.UTF-8"
LC_MONETARY="it_IT.UTF-8"
LC_MESSAGES="it_IT.UTF-8"
LC_PAPER="it_IT.UTF-8"
LC_NAME="it_IT.UTF-8"
LC_ADDRESS="it_IT.UTF-8"
LC_TELEPHONE="it_IT.UTF-8"
LC_MEASUREMENT="it_IT.UTF-8"
LC_IDENTIFICATION="it_IT.UTF-8"
LC_ALL=
Se si desidera cambiarla, si deve far ricorso al comando:
<pre># dpkg-reconfigure locales</pre>
con cui si possono scegliere tutte le localizzazioni volute attraverso i tasti freccia giù/su, tab, barra spaziatrice e invio.<br/>
Si scelgano liberamente purché contengano almeno "it_IT.UTF-8" e "en_US.UTF-8". UTF-8 è la codifica ormai standard su tutti i sistemi (vecchie applicazioni o file potrebbero utilizzare ancora la codifica "iso8859") mentre la lingua inglese può essere utile in molti casi (come ad esempio inviare un report con [[reportbug]]) ed è consigliato selezionarla.
{| style="width:100%; background:transparent;"
| align="center" |
{|cellpadding="11"
| [[Immagine:Locale1.png|400px|link=]]
| [[Immagine:Locale2.png|400px|link=]]
|-
|}
|}
Nella successiva schermata si potrà scegliere la localizzazione predefinita, quindi verrà modificato il file <code>/etc/default/locale</code> in base alla scelta fatta. Servirà ora un logout/login per rendere effettivi i cambiamenti.


'''[LOCALECONF]''' questo pacchetto gestisce la configurazione delle variabili d'ambiente
Notare che la scelta della localizzazione influenzerà molte applicazioni di base del sistema oltre che i loro messaggi. Sarà modificata la lingua con cui vengono visualizzate ad esempio le [[manpages]], il sistema debconf, gli output normali o di errore e, qualora fosse installato, il comportamento di <code>localepurge</code>. Potrebbe, inoltre, cambiare anche la lingua delle applicazioni grafiche che si basano sulla variabile "LANG".
La prima maschera ci chiede se vogliamo gestire il file di configurazione tramite debconf e noi rispondiamo ovviamente di . La maschera seguente fornisce unicamente informazioni e premiamo OK.


A questo punto scegliamo la localizzazione di default per il nostro sistema (ovviamente <code>it_IT@euro ISO-8859-15</code>) e procediamo.
== Applicazioni grafiche ==
Se si è all'interno di un Desktop Environment come KDE o GNOME, la lingua viene impostata automaticamente in fase di installazione. Negli altri casi, per cambiarla, è sufficiente installare i pacchetti adatti per la lingua.


Diamo sempre l'ok fino a trovarci ad una finestra che ci chiede quali settaggi dell'ambiente vogliamo sovrascrivere ( "Select the environment settings that should override the default locale." ) e indichiamoli tutti.
=== KDE ===
Il pacchetto che contiene la localizzazione in italiano è "kde-l10n-it":
<pre># apt-get install kde-l10n-it</pre>
quindi si può scegliere la lingua attraverso le impostazioni di sistema, voce "Localizzazione".<br/>
Potrebbe essere necessario chiudere e riaprire KDE per ottenere i cambiamenti desiderati.


Fatto questo premiamo OK a tutte le successive proposte, badando sempre che sia selezionato il nostro <code>it_IT</code>.
=== Altre applicazioni ===
La applicazioni grafiche, a volte, necessitano anche dell'installazione di pacchetti aggiuntivi contenenti la localizzazione voluta.<br/>
Qui di seguito verranno indicati i pacchetti da installare per avere la lingua italiana in diverse applicazioni grafiche:<br/>
'''Iceweasel''' - iceweasel-l10n-<br/>
'''Icedove''' - icedove-l10n-<br/>
'''Libreoffice''' - libreoffice-l10n-it


{{Box|Nota:|il pacchetto '''localeconf''' è disponibile solo per Sarge(oldstable)}}


{{Autori
{{Autori
|Autore=[[Utente:Keltik|Keltik]]
|Autore=[[Utente:Keltik|Keltik]]
Autore adottivo: [[Utente:Pmate|pmate]] 11:27, 18 ott 2011 (CEST)
|Estesa_da=
:[[Utente:S3v|S3v]] 09:41, 2 ago 2013 (CEST)
|Verificata_da=
:[[Utente:S3v|S3v]] 09:41, 2 ago 2013 (CEST)
|Numero_revisori=1
}}
}}


[[Categoria:Ottimizzazione del sistema]]
[[Categoria:Ottimizzazione del sistema]]
[[Categoria:Shell]]
[[Categoria:Shell]]

Versione delle 07:41, 2 ago 2013

Debian-swirl.png Versioni Compatibili

Tutte le versioni supportate di Debian

Installer

Durante l'installazione di Debian verrà chiesto esplicitamente la lingua da utilizzare.
Questa sarà la lingua non solo adottata nei passi successivi dell'installazione ma anche, ad installazione ultimata, per l'intero sistema.

Locale3.png

Ciò che viene indicato qui condizionerà anche la lista dei repository raccomandati dall'installer. In ogni modo tutte le scelte fatte potranno essere facilmente cambiate in futuro.

La lingua di sistema

La lingua utilizzata è indicata dalla variabile d'ambiente "LANG", per visualizzarla:

$ echo $LANG

Oppure si può adoperare il comando locale:

$ locale

Questa, per una localizzazione in italiano, dovrebbe apparire così:

$ echo $LANG
it_IT.UTF-8

o, con locale:

LANG=it_IT.UTF-8
LANGUAGE=
LC_CTYPE="it_IT.UTF-8"
LC_NUMERIC="it_IT.UTF-8"
LC_TIME="it_IT.UTF-8"
LC_COLLATE="it_IT.UTF-8"
LC_MONETARY="it_IT.UTF-8"
LC_MESSAGES="it_IT.UTF-8"
LC_PAPER="it_IT.UTF-8"
LC_NAME="it_IT.UTF-8"
LC_ADDRESS="it_IT.UTF-8"
LC_TELEPHONE="it_IT.UTF-8"
LC_MEASUREMENT="it_IT.UTF-8"
LC_IDENTIFICATION="it_IT.UTF-8"
LC_ALL=

Se si desidera cambiarla, si deve far ricorso al comando:

# dpkg-reconfigure locales

con cui si possono scegliere tutte le localizzazioni volute attraverso i tasti freccia giù/su, tab, barra spaziatrice e invio.
Si scelgano liberamente purché contengano almeno "it_IT.UTF-8" e "en_US.UTF-8". UTF-8 è la codifica ormai standard su tutti i sistemi (vecchie applicazioni o file potrebbero utilizzare ancora la codifica "iso8859") mentre la lingua inglese può essere utile in molti casi (come ad esempio inviare un report con reportbug) ed è consigliato selezionarla.

Locale1.png Locale2.png

Nella successiva schermata si potrà scegliere la localizzazione predefinita, quindi verrà modificato il file /etc/default/locale in base alla scelta fatta. Servirà ora un logout/login per rendere effettivi i cambiamenti.

Notare che la scelta della localizzazione influenzerà molte applicazioni di base del sistema oltre che i loro messaggi. Sarà modificata la lingua con cui vengono visualizzate ad esempio le manpages, il sistema debconf, gli output normali o di errore e, qualora fosse installato, il comportamento di localepurge. Potrebbe, inoltre, cambiare anche la lingua delle applicazioni grafiche che si basano sulla variabile "LANG".

Applicazioni grafiche

Se si è all'interno di un Desktop Environment come KDE o GNOME, la lingua viene impostata automaticamente in fase di installazione. Negli altri casi, per cambiarla, è sufficiente installare i pacchetti adatti per la lingua.

KDE

Il pacchetto che contiene la localizzazione in italiano è "kde-l10n-it":

# apt-get install kde-l10n-it

quindi si può scegliere la lingua attraverso le impostazioni di sistema, voce "Localizzazione".
Potrebbe essere necessario chiudere e riaprire KDE per ottenere i cambiamenti desiderati.

Altre applicazioni

La applicazioni grafiche, a volte, necessitano anche dell'installazione di pacchetti aggiuntivi contenenti la localizzazione voluta.
Qui di seguito verranno indicati i pacchetti da installare per avere la lingua italiana in diverse applicazioni grafiche:
Iceweasel - iceweasel-l10n-
Icedove - icedove-l10n-
Libreoffice - libreoffice-l10n-it




Guida scritta da: Keltik Swirl-auth40.png Debianized 40%
Estesa da:
S3v 09:41, 2 ago 2013 (CEST)
Verificata da:
S3v 09:41, 2 ago 2013 (CEST)

Verificare ed estendere la guida | Cos'è una guida Debianized